STERLING
HEIGHTS, MI - SportRack Automotive introduces
Smart-Pack(tm), the most versatile and practical platform
carrier system available. Smart-Pack is an open platform carrier,
a bicycle carrier and an enclosed carrier - all in one.

SportRack's three-in-one carrier can carry up to three bicycles,
while its heavy-duty tray design protects gear from road debris
and water spray.
Optional features include a soft-top weather resistant enclosure,
a rear stop taillight package, cargo rack, bicycle mounts,
rooftop system compliant bars and B-line metal framing system
hardware for custom applications.
Smart-Pack is best used in conjunction with the Twin-Tube
frame-and-spine system, also from SportRack. Designed as a
revolutionary system for attaching hitch-mounted accessories
into a 2" or 1 1/4" receiver, Twin-Tube currently
accommodates the Smart-Pack and a growing number of SportRack
Automotive accessories. The universal bracket system eliminates
the need to convert mounting hardware each time you change
cargo carriers - saving valuable time and reducing hassle.
An original invention of Sport Performance Carrier(r) manufacturer
Let's Go Aero (LGA), the Smart-Pack (called Triple-Play(tm)
under LGA) was recently licensed to SportRack Automotive in
an agreement with LGA. Under terms of the deal, SportRack
Automotive now holds exclusive OEM rights to the Smart-Pack
technology.
Headquartered in Sterling Heights, Mich., SportRack Automotive
(SRA) is a global leader in the supply of roof rack systems
and lifestyle accessory products to the global automotive
OEM and aftermarket. SRA has additional North American operations
in Port Huron, Shelby Township, and Sterling Heights, Mich.;
Williston, Vt.; Hamer Bay, Ontario; and Granby, Quebec. SportRack's
European operations are headquartered in Sandhausen, Germany,
and also include manufacturing facilities in Bakov, Czech
Republic and Barcelona, Spain. The Smart-Pack will be produced
at the SportRack Accessories facility in Granby, Quebec.
